CNN conducted a study to analyze and generate travel trends which can prove to be of great benefits to the vacation planners in 2010. However recession is still a major reason for lower traveling rates and lower traveling budgets.

Keeping all the money crunch facts in mind CNN asked the travel industry experts about the traveling trends. The experts said that people will continue to travel which is good news.

There are some good and bad things that the travelers will have to face. As per experts the car rental rates are going to rise and so are prices of air travel tickets. The hotels will continue to keep their rates as they are or increase them slightly they have been facing a hard time and cannot miss out on customers by increasing the room rates. Cruise lines have increased their rates and no further hike is expected at least from the big players in 2010.

Petrol and gas prices will continue to shoot up during summers which will ultimately make travel by car, air or ship an expensive affair. But summers being the prime holidaying season people will have to compromise on their travel budget.

However the good news is travelers can expect some exciting offers and package discounts on air travel and hotel stays. So travelers can cross check for hotel rates, International and Domestic air tickets before choosing the final deal. 2009 did not to prove to be a great year for the travel and tourism industry and this year they will surely want to turn around the figures.
